Issues in Educational Research encourages beginning researchers as well as more experienced academics and writers. Consequently approximately 50% of the articles are from part time or full time students doing Masters or PhD research. By submitting to Issues in Educational Research, beginning researchers are familiarising themselves with the demands of peer review, revision and rewriting. This is invaluable experience for young researchers, and supervisors are advised to encourage their postgraduate students to write and submit articles as an integral part of their research activities. IIER is an open access journal. For more details, see http://education.curtin.edu.au/iier/

Contents for IIER's current issue may be read at http://education.curtin.edu.au/iier/ and the same page gives access to full text for all issues from Volume 1(1), 1991. ISSN 0313-7155. IIER is a peer reviewed academic journal drawing most of its submissions from educational researchers in Australia and countries in the Australasian region.
